AIK Stockholm Sign Nigerian Wonderkid Zadok Yohanna Amid Interest from Europe and Asia

Swedish Allsvenskan club AIK Stockholm have completed the signing of 18-year-old Nigerian wonderkid Zadok Yohanna on a long-term contract from Nigerian-based side Ikon Allah Football Academy, Footy-Africa reports.

The highly rated Nigerian talent’s move to AIK Stockholm puts an end to intense transfer speculation, with the midfielder previously linked to several clubs across Europe, Scandinavia, and Asia.

In an exclusive interview, player agent Roni Layous revealed the reasons behind choosing AIK Stockholm despite receiving offers from top clubs abroad. He described the young midfielder as a future star of the Nigeria national team.

β€œWe have been guiding and supporting Zadok for years β€” a humble boy who improves day by day. A work machine that always wants more,” Layous said.

β€œIt was clear to us that it was only a matter of time before we made a big move for Zadok. After receiving different offers and weighing several options, we chose AIK β€” a huge, historic club with a massive fanbase.”

β€œAIK is just the first European stop in Zadok’s journey. I believe it’s only a matter of time before we see him at the highest level of football, achieving his childhood dream of representing the Super Eagles,” Layous concluded.

The highly coveted Nigerian midfielder, who recently turned 18, was previously linked to UAE side Al Wasl FC among other top clubs interested in securing his signature.
